Enemies shouldn't fall to begin with if you shove them away. In 5e, "Shove Prone" and "Shove Away" are two separate actions, but Larian hasn't implemented the former for some reason.
- You want to move an enemy away so you can move without provoking attacks or make attacks at not-Disadvantage? You don't also get the free benefit of making them prone.
- You want to shove an enemy prone, giving Advantage on adjacent attacks against them and Disadvantage on theirs? You don't also get the free benefit of shoving them away.

An exception could be if the enemy takes fall damage -> they make a Dex (or Str) ST to remain standing, with the DC dependent on the damage taken.

In the game you cannot be Prone while it is your turn at all - falling prone immediately ends your turn, and you automatically recover from prone at the beginning of your turn.

We cannot say whether Larian's game code allows you to attack while prone, because other circumstances of their code prevent us from ever having the opportunity - namely that 'prone' carries with it 'unconscious', so whenever you are 'prone' for whatever reason, you are also 'unconscious', and thus incapacitated and incapable of doing anything at all.

This needs to be fixed, but has been like this for along, long time and despite numerous reports has not been corrected yet.
